Introduction

If you're interested in hatching your own eggs, understanding incubadoras para huevos is crucial. These incubators are specially designed to mimic the natural conditions required for eggs to develop and hatch. With an incubadora, you can control the temperature and humidity, ensuring the eggs receive the best care possible. Whether you're a hobbyist or a small-scale farmer, investing in a quality incubadora para huevos can significantly enhance your hatching success rate.

Here are some key features to consider when choosing an incubadora:
  • Temperature Control: Look for models that offer precise temperature settings.
  • Humidity Regulation: Proper humidity is vital for egg development; choose an incubator with adjustable humidity controls.
  • Capacity: Depending on your needs, select an incubator that can accommodate the number of eggs you plan to hatch.
  • Automatic Egg Turner: This feature helps ensure even heating and prevents the eggs from sticking to the incubator.
  • Ease of Use: Opt for models with user-friendly interfaces for better monitoring and adjustments.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using incubadoras para huevos?

Common mistakes include not monitoring temperature and humidity levels closely, overcrowding the incubator, and failing to turn the eggs regularly.

What types of eggs can I hatch using an incubadora?

You can hatch various types of eggs, including chicken, duck, quail, and even some exotic bird eggs, depending on the incubator's specifications.

How long does it take for eggs to hatch in an incubadora?

The incubation period varies by species, but chicken eggs typically take about 21 days, while duck eggs may take around 28 days.
